  • Publication number: 20250348914
    Abstract: A method includes: receiving, via a webpage of a third-party marketplace, a first set of text-based and image-based data samples, pertaining to a product; receiving, via a management portal of the third-party marketplace, a second set of text-based and image-based data samples pertaining to the product; retrieving, from an internal data storage system, a third set of text-based and image-based data samples pertaining to the product; generating binary hashes of the first, second, and third sets of image-based data samples; comparing the binary hashes and outputting binary results based on agreement, or disagreement, of the binary hashes; extracting attributes from the first, second, and third sets of text-based data samples; comparing the attributes and outputting additional binary results based on agreement, or disagreement, of the attributes; and executing a data re-syndication algorithm based on at least one disagreement of either the compared binary hashes or the compared attributes.

  • Publication number: 20250348525
    Abstract: A method includes: receiving, from a user, a request to import a product listing onto a webpage of a third-party marketplace; retrieving, via a management portal of the third-party marketplace, an indication of text-based fields to be completed prior to importing the product listing; retrieving, from an internal data storage system, normalized text-based data samples that pertain to the product listing; generating an initial mapping between respective ones of the text-based fields and respective ones of the normalized text-based data samples; determining that a given text-based field does not match any of the normalized text-based data samples; generating, via natural language processing, an additional mapping between a given normalized text-based data sample and the given text-based field; providing the initial and additional mappings to the user; and providing the initial mapping and the additional mapping to the management portal for importation of the product listing onto the webpage.

  • Patent number: 12254354
    Abstract: A method for conserving resources in a distributed system includes receiving an event-criteria list from a resource controller. The event-criteria list includes one or more events watched by the resource controller and the resource controller controls at least one target resource and is configured to respond to events from the event-criteria list that occur. The method also includes determining whether the resource controller is idle. When the resource controller is idle, the method includes terminating the resource controller, determining whether any event from the event-criteria list occurs after terminating the resource controller, and, when at least one event from the event-criteria list occurs after terminating the resource controller, recreating the resource controller.

  • Patent number: 12000774
    Abstract: An embodiment of a gas analyzer is described that comprises a light source configured to produce a substantially collimated first beam with a diverging angle of less than about 15 degrees; a gas cell comprising an inlet configured to introduce a gas into the gas cell, an outlet configured to remove the gas from the gas cell, and a plurality of mirrors configured to reflect the substantially collimated first beam within the gas cell; and a detector configured to generate a signal in response to the substantially collimated first beam.

  • Patent number: 11605224
    Abstract: Techniques disclosed for managing video captured by an imaging device. Methods disclosed capture a video in response to a capture command received at the imaging device. Following a video capture, techniques for classifying the captured video based on feature(s) extracted therefrom, for marking the captured video based on the classification, and for generating a media item from the captured video according to the marking are disclosed. Accordingly, the captured video may be classified as representing a static event, and, as a result, a media item of a still image may be generated. Otherwise, the captured video may be classified as representing a dynamic event, and, as a result, a media item of a video may be generated.

  • Patent number: 11486883
    Abstract: The invention provides a method for controlling contaminants in biopharmaceutical purification processes by using light scattering and UV absorbance to establish a determinant. The invention makes use of multi-angle light scattering (MALS) and UV as a continuous monitoring system to provide information about the elution peak fractions in real-time instead of conventional pooling methods that rely on a predetermined percent UV peak max value to initiate the pooling process; regardless of product quality.

  • Publication number: 20220099582
    Abstract: An embodiment of an analyzer is described that comprises a first conduit configured to channel an annular flow of a first gas; a second conduit positioned within the first conduit, where the outer dimension of the second conduit is separated from an inner dimension of the first conduit by a gap configured to channel an axial flow of a second gas; a reaction chamber fluidically coupled to the first conduit and the second conduit, where the reaction chamber comprises a window on a side opposite from an orifice of the first conduit into the reaction chamber; and a detector positioned adjacent to a side of the window opposite from the reaction chamber, wherein the detector is configured to receive light produced from a reaction of the first gas and the second gas in the reaction chamber.
